Can Flux’s AI Copilot read datasheets or suggest component choices?

Yes. Copilot uses AI to process datasheet information and provide recommendations for PCB layout and component selection. It can suggest parts based on specifications and flag potential mismatches

What's the difference between the original Copilot and the new Copilot Chat?

Flux has upgraded to a new Copilot Chat interface which replaces the original Copilot tab and Copilot in canvas comment threads. The new Copilot Chat tab offers improved AI capabilities and a more streamlined user experience. The original Copilot is still available in pre-Copilot Chat projects but is being phased out.

Key differences:

  • You no longer need to tag "@copilot" or select Copilot Experts in your messages
  • Access Copilot directly through the Chat tab in the right sidebar
  • Enhanced AI capabilities with improved context understanding
  • Improved tools and actions that allow Copilot to perform tasks on your behalf, such as:
  • Adding, editing, or removing components and nets
  • Changing component designators and properties
  • Assisting with routing and layout suggestions

Can I use JavaScript or scripting to automate tasks?

No, apart from writing simulation models, Flux does not support scripting for automating PCB design.

Will Flux’s AI Copilot optimize my schematic or PCB layout automatically?

Copilot provides recommendations and assists with tasks like:

  • Searching the library
  • Performing calculations
  • Add, remove, or replace components in a project
  • Re-assign designators and component values.
  • Assisting with wiring
  • Analyzing images However, you retain final control over design decisions.
